Paediatric Occupational Therapist - Berkshire

Our clientis seeking a dedicated Paediatric Occupational Therapist to provide specialist OT provision to pupils with autism. This role involves delivering high-quality assessment, intervention, and support within an educational setting, working as part of a multi-disciplinary team to ensure pupils achieve their full potential.

Key Responsibilities Clinical Practice and Intervention
  • Maintain responsibility for OT interventions, ensuring high standards of care.
  • Provide direct therapy to pupils as outlined in their EHCPs.
  • Deliver small group OT sessions and develop individualized and class-based intervention programs.
  • Embed OT strategies throughout the school environment.
  • Collaborate with a wider team of therapists and adhere to professional ethical standards.
Assessment and Equipment
  • Assess for specialist equipment, make recommendations, and ensure safe setup.
  • Train parents, carers, and staff in equipment use and monitor safety.
Training and Support
  • Plan and deliver staff training sessions and parent information sessions.
  • Support the implementation of OT strategies across the school environment.
Professional Standards
  • Maintain accurate clinical records, write detailed reports, and contribute to reviews.
  • Manage workload efficiently and participate in CPD activities.
  • Stay current with research, guidelines, and legislation relevant to practice.
Multi-Disciplinary Working
  • Collaborate effectively with education staff, therapists, and other professionals.
  • Contribute to multi-disciplinary assessments and provide specialist advice.
